The Stealth Cloud
                                                                                             Topic 3

§  The Stealth Cloud
       §  how to manage BU’s implementing Cloud apps without IT involevement –
       §  focus on business cloud applications
       §  moving away from the IT/infrastructure debate and focusing on how the
           business is rapidly adopting this important and – very often – bypassing IT who
           is still coming to terms with this tsunami
       §  Everything as a service will alter business models and IT procurement.
